About The Position

Trussco Offshore is seeking an experienced Blaster Painter to join their team. The role involves preparing surfaces for final coating applications, ensuring safety and compliance with industry standards. The position requires availability for 24-hour callouts and offers competitive pay based on experience, along with overtime opportunities.

Requirements

  • Previous blaster or tank/vessel cleaning experience is REQUIRED.
  • Experience with a variety of coating types and blast media.
  • Able to rig with cable, beams, and boards.
  • Knowledge of air operated spiders.
  • Must possess a T.W.I.C. card (Transportation Worker Identification Card).
  • Able to use swing rope to board boat or platform.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are surfaces for final coating application through various methods including masking, degreasing, and containment.
  • Operate various tools in accordance with the company's safety policy.
  • Set up all blast pots, route blast lines, air lines, and lighting in accordance with OSHA standards.
  • Inspect, prepare, and maintain equipment and work area for blast and coating operations.
  • Wear the personal protective equipment prescribed by posted signs, written instructions, and work permits.
  • Participate in company safety training programs.
  • Report all accidents and near misses involving self, company vehicles, or others to the manager immediately.
  • Maintain regular and timely attendance at work and/or customer properties.
